The Clarkstown Police Department has announced the retirement of Sergeant Dan Burke, who is stepping down after more than 28 years of dedicated service to the community.
Sergeant Burke began his career with the department in July 1996 and was promoted to sergeant in 2014. Before joining the force, he proudly served in the U.S. Navy.
Throughout his tenure, Burke took on multiple critical roles, including serving on the department’s Critical Incident Response Team (CIRT), working with the Rockland County Narcotics Task Force, and being an esteemed member of the Honor Guard.
His dedication and valor were recognized with several prestigious awards, including the Medal of Valor and the Combat Cross.
The Clarkstown Police Department expressed its deep appreciation for Sergeant Burke’s service and extended best wishes as he transitions into retirement.
